For Immediate Release - The Adult Webmaster Toolbar

GA Media Corp launches the Adult Webmaster Toolbar

The AdultWebmasterToolbar.com, a new resource facility that allows adult webmasters to find industry information on the go.

Daytona Beach, Florida USA - June 12, 2003 - GA Media Corporation launches the AdultWebmasterToolbar.com today. The new webmaster tool is designed to allow webmasters to navigate industry information from a single browser toolbar.. Webmasters can find a multitude of resources, community forums, online statistics, news and information directly without combing browser history or endless bookmarks. The Adult Webmaster Toolbar will bring them right where they want to be. As it has received high marks from industry and beta partners, this automated adult webmaster resource is expected to receive high traffic upon its launch.

?The Adult Webmaster Toolbar has been developed with the webmaster in mind. We discussed the features with our test group to see if a tool like this would be used and what features they wanted to have. This is about the webmaster, so we have included quick links to popular forums, program stats pages they decided on, as well as news and information they look for. In a sense, the Adult Webmaster Toolbar incorporates the entire webmaster community and attaches it to the browser window.? Gary Alan, CEO GA Media Corp.

?More than a beginning of a very valuable product for the adult webmaster community?? Gary Kremen, CEO and Founder - Sex.com

The "resources on the go" approach of AdultWebmasterToolbar will give the user the information they want through a simple add-on to their browser window. The toolbar, and accompanying web site, offers those companies marketing services and product a highly visible vehicle for industry exposure.

Quote:
Originally posted by Carrie
If a link is added to the database, is it automatically added to everyone's toolbar?
IOW, do queries and "one-click" interaction from the toolbar directly query your database or is there a pre-set bunch of links (like many sponsors are doing now with downloadable bookmark folders) that go in and then have to be updated from time to time?
Carrie,

I'm not sure if I'm reading this correctly so please excuse me...

Searches and main menu selections, like Affiliate Programs, Content Providers, etc. go to the real time database on the server. So if a webmaster installed the toolbar yesterday, new additions to the database, today, are available.

For the moment, selections from Stat, Forums, News and HotSites are dynamically predefined.

The toolbar itself, once installed, needs no updating. Once it is on, the information is pulled from the server.

When we complete Version 2.0, an update MAY be necessary to accommodate new functionalities, like those asked for here.
